SpaceX Considering $2 Billion Investment in Elon Musk’s Artificial Intelligence Startup, xAI

SpaceX Considering $2 Billion Investment in Elon Musk’s Artificial Intelligence Startup, xAI

In a significant development, it appears that SpaceX, Elon Musk’s renowned space exploration company, is set to make a substantial investment in xAI, Musk’s artificial intelligence startup. According to reliable sources close to SpaceX, as reported by The Wall Street Journal, the company has agreed to inject $2 billion into xAI as part of a larger $10 billion fundraising endeavor, which includes both equity and debt components.

This investment, if confirmed, would mark SpaceX’s initial foray into investing in another company and one of its most substantial investments to date. The Journal notes that SpaceX currently utilizes xAI’s chatbot Grok to power customer service for its Starlink internet service, with plans for further collaborative ventures.

Elon Musk has a history of leveraging his various companies to mutually reinforce each other’s endeavors. An instance of this is the merger of xAI with X (previously known as Twitter) earlier in the year. Despite recent controversies surrounding Grok, such as its antisemitic commentary and self-referential description as “MechaHitler,” Tesla has reportedly decided to integrate Grok into its vehicles.

It is essential to note that this information is based on reports from The Wall Street Journal and the details are yet to be officially confirmed by SpaceX or xAI.
